This is an introductory class that helps students acquire and develop fundamental drawing skills. The class emphasizes traditional drawing techniques including line, value, composition and linear perspective. Students will work on still life and xcbasic forms from observation and communicate ideas through a variety of black and white media. In this class, students will learn: • basic observation methods and skills • basic drawing elements: line, shape • perspectives and space relationships form, mass, texture, value & volume • composition and space arrangement • proportional relationships and measurements

Required Supplies

  • 18X24 Sketch Paper, Such as Biggie Sketch by Canson or Dick Blick Brand Sketch Paper
  • 18X24 Drawing Paper
  • https://www.dickblick.com/items/strathmore-400-series-drawing-paper-pad-18-x-24-24-sheets/
  • 9×12 sketchbook
  • Graphite pencils- 2H, H, HB, 2B, 4B, 6B
  • Kneaded Eraser
  • White Vinyl Eraser or pink pearl Art gum eraser
  • Small click eraser
  • https://www.dickblick.com/products/generals-factis-mechanical-eraser
  • MICRO eraser (optional)
  • https://www.dickblick.com/items/tombow-mono-zero-refillable-eraser-round-single/
  • Metal pencil sharpener
  • Box cutter
  • Sandpaper
  • Medium vine charcoal
  • small box Chamois or soft rag
  • BBQ Skewer or thin knitting needle for measuring
  • Soft clean paintbrush 1-2” ish (just to dust off eraser crumbs and charcoal dust)
  • 12-17″ Clear grid ruler
  • https://www.dickblick.com/items/westcott-beveled-plastic-ruler-18-8ths/
  • Drafting tape
  • View finder, DIY chip board or index cards OK
  • https://www.dickblick.com/items/viewcatcher-3-12-x-3-12-plastic
  • 2 large binder or bulldog clips
  • sharpener
